精准投递
2024-05-15 21:56:33
1
举报
对比集群广播,利用redis记录每台websocket的IP地址,通过router服务精准推送到指定的websocket上,但是在群聊环境下写扩散系数爆炸,会导致redis访问压力过大和router单点性能问题.
C
websocket
10.101.1.2
IM服务
Channel
A
线程池
10.101.1.1
B
4.推送消息
2.推送消息给C
3.获取A的Channel
........
连接管理
Router
1.获取目标Ip
消息封装
Redis